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Versapay Logo

Senior FullStack Software Engineer- React & Ruby on Rails

Versapay

Salary not specified
Aug 21, 2025
Remote, US
Apply Now

Versapay's Accounts Receivable Efficiency Suite simplifies the invoice-to-cash process by automating invoicing, facilitating B2B payments, and streamlining cash application with AI. Versapay integrates natively with top ERPs, while allowing businesses to collect with a self-serve payment portal and collaborate with customers and teammates to resolve what automation alone can’t.

Requirements

  • Expertise in React.js and modern JavaScript/TypeScript development.
  • Experience with Ruby on Rails or a strong willingness and ability to learn it quickly.
  • Solid understanding of algorithms, data structures, and system design.
  • Strong debugging and problem-solving skills, especially in complex or ambiguous situations.
  • Proven experience building and shipping fullstackSaaS applications in an agile, test-driven environment.
  • Experience in the Payments industry and/or PCI/DSS compliance is a strong asset.

Responsibilities

  • Design, develop, and test fullstack product features that meet business and technical requirements.
  • Collaborate with your squad to plan, scope, and implement new features and enhancements.
  • Estimate work methodically based on iterative learning and agile best practices.
  • Investigate and resolve performance, scalability, security and data integrity issues.
  • Participate in code reviews, architecture discussions, and technical decision-making.
  • Work closely with Product, QA, DevOps, and Customer Care to deliver value to our users.
  • Contribute to R&D efforts to ensure our platform is scalable, reliable, and secure.

Other

  • 7+ years of experience in software engineering, with a strong foundation in computer science, engineering, or mathematics.
  • Mentor junior engineers and foster a culture of continuous learning and improvement.
  • Excellent communication skills—clear, concise, and effective in both written and verbal formats.
  • A collaborative mindset with the ability to work independently and take ownership.
  • LI-Remote